Sean 'Diddy' Combs & Kim Porter: A Biographical Snapshot
To understand the complexity of the allegations, it is essential to first establish the background of the two key figures who shared a life, a family, and a long history in the public eye.
Sean 'Diddy' Combs (P. Diddy, Puff Daddy, Puffy, Brother Love)
- Born: Sean John Combs, November 4, 1969, in Harlem, New York City.
- Career: American rapper, record producer, record executive, actor, and entrepreneur. Founded Bad Boy Records.
- Relationship with Kim Porter: Began dating in the early 1990s and had an on-again, off-again relationship that lasted through 2007.
- Children: Shares three biological children with Kim Porter: Christian Combs (born 1998) and twin daughters D'Lila Star and Jessie James (born 2006). He also raised Kim's eldest son, Quincy Brown (born 1991), whose father is Al B. Sure!
Kimberly Antwinette Porter
- Born: December 15, 1970, in Columbus, Georgia.
- Career: American model and actress. She moved to New York at age 16 after signing with Elite Model Management. She was also a member of the girl group Girl 6.
- Cause of Death: Died on November 15, 2018, at the age of 47. The official cause of death was lobar pneumonia.
- Relationship with Diddy: Known primarily as Diddy's long-term girlfriend and the mother of four of his children.
The Official Facts of Kim Porter's Tragic Death
Kim Porter's sudden passing in November 2018 sent shockwaves through the entertainment industry. The official record is clear, but it has not stopped the spread of unconfirmed rumors.
Porter was found deceased in her Toluca Lake, California, home. Following an autopsy and toxicology tests, the Los Angeles County Department of Medical Examiner-Coroner officially ruled her death as natural.
- Official Cause: Lobar pneumonia.
- Circumstances: Porter had been suffering from flu-like symptoms for several weeks prior to her death.
- Diddy's Reaction: Sean Combs expressed deep grief and devotion to his late partner, stating he would "raise our family just the way we talked about."
Despite the official ruling, the sheer shock of her unexpected death at a young age, coupled with the high-profile nature of her ex-partner, has fueled years of speculation and conspiracy theories.
The Shocking Allegations from the Purported Memoir
The most direct and concerning answer to "What did Diddy do to Kim" came from the circulation of a 60-page book, titled as a memoir attributed to Kim Porter, which detailed claims of physical and sexual abuse at the hands of Sean Combs.
Key Allegations Detailed in the Denounced Book
The purported memoir, which was briefly available on Amazon before being pulled, contained several explosive and highly sensitive claims that have since become a major point of discussion in the media. These claims remain unproven and have been vehemently denied by the Combs family.
- Forced Sexual Activity: One of the most severe claims alleged that in 1996, Diddy forced both Kim Porter and another woman to take ecstasy and engage in sexual activity together. This specific allegation has been reported in the context of Diddy's broader sexual misconduct lawsuits.
- Physical and Sexual Assault: The book reportedly detailed multiple instances of alleged physical and sexual assault that Kim Porter endured during their relationship.
- Control and Coercion: The narrative allegedly suggested a pattern of psychological control and coercion by Combs over Porter throughout their time together.
The Family's Response and Denial
In a strongly worded statement, Sean Combs' representatives and his children with Kim Porter—Quincy, Christian, D'Lila, and Jessie—denounced the book as a "fake" and a "fraudulent" attempt to exploit their late mother's name.
The family's public stance is that Kim Porter did not write a memoir, and the contents of the circulating book are entirely fabricated. Amazon eventually removed the book from its platform, lending credence to the family's claims that it was an unauthorized and false publication.
The Resurfacing of Death Conspiracy Theories
The recent wave of legal and public scrutiny against Diddy has provided a platform for long-simmering conspiracy theories about Kim Porter’s death to gain traction. These theories directly challenge the official finding of death by pneumonia.
Al B. Sure!'s Public Accusation
One of the most high-profile figures to publicly voice suspicion is singer-songwriter Al B. Sure!, the biological father of Kim Porter's eldest son, Quincy Brown. In a recent interview, Al B. Sure! openly stated that he suspects Sean Combs was involved in the death of his late ex-girlfriend, Kim Porter.
Al B. Sure! noted that Kim Porter "was in the best of health" before her sudden illness and death, raising questions about the severity and speed of the pneumonia that claimed her life.
The Children's Unified Front
In response to the renewed circulation of these unproven rumors, Diddy and Kim Porter's children issued a collective statement. They firmly shut down the "conspiracy theories" surrounding their mother's true cause of death, reaffirming the medical examiner's official finding of pneumonia.
This public display of unity from the children—Quincy, Christian, D'Lila, and Jessie—underscores the painful position they are in, navigating the public storm while protecting their mother's memory and their father's reputation.
